#1 Mercedes-Benz Stadium (Atlanta United)

Capacity – 42,500 expandable to at least 71,874

It would quite the hot take to say the brand new Mercedes-Benz Stadium isn’t the best venue in Major League Soccer. Although it doubles as a football arena for the Atlanta Falcons, the stadium fits perfectly around the soccer field. The fans on the lower level sit as close as they can to the touchline, giving them a realistic experience.

The sheer size of the stadium gives it a leg up among the others on its own. Prior to its opening, some would say the 70,000+ capacity would be a bit much for when the five stripes take the field, however in their inaugural season they set the all-time MLS single-game attendance record with 70,425 fans on September 16th when Orlando City came to town.

In addition to these great attendance numbers, Atlanta United fans are treated with low priced food and beverages when they attend games. Mercedes-Benz Stadium introduced  “Fan First”, menu pricing for their inaugural season and will continue it for the upcoming campaign. What’s not to love about that?
